About the Book
 
Fun, humorous and clever, this beginning reader picture sparks children’s
imaginations through mixed up animals, while delivering a message of
self-esteem and being proud of who they are.
 
  Often children wish they were someone other than whom they are. A shy child might wish
for boldness, while a short child yearns to be tall. But appreciating oneself is the key to a happy and healthy life, suggests author Salvatore Puglisi, and he imparts this wise lesson in this delightfully illustrated book.

Parents will love the warm, compassionate way the author addresses self-image, but children will adore artist David Byrne’s dazzling and funny illustrations. Unsatisfied with who they are, a group of animals imagine different identities. A bear daydreams about being a butterfly, a rabbit scrunches into a turtle shell and a dog takes on wings... all with unexpected results. Gradually, the characters discover that they would rather be themselves, as will countless children after reading this inspiring picture book.
